The American Red Cross Tsunami Recovery Program (TRP) had been established to direct the organization’s response to the South Asia tsunami disaster. The TRP activities focus on integrated community recovery and preparedness interventions in tsunami affected countries in Asia and East Africa in collaboration with Red Cross and non-Red Cross partners. The Indonesia TRP Delegation operates from offices in Banda Aceh, Calang, Lamno. It also has liaison offices in Jakarta, and other areas in Aceh province in collaboration with the Indonesian Red Cross.
